1,000 Books Before Kindergarten

1000 Books Before Kindergarten graphic header

How it Works

  • Sign up! Stop by the Children's Reference Desk, show your Ela Library card and fill out a quick registration form.
  • You will receive a log to keep track of your reading and a sturdy tote bag to carry all of your books.
  • After you complete the program, your child will receive a t-shirt prize and can take a photo with our finisher sign.

When should I start?

We encourage you to begin reading to your child as a baby, or even sooner during pregnancy. Language is soothing and enriching for your child from a very young age.

How long will it take to complete?

1,000 books sounds like a lot! But if you read just one book a day, you will finish in under three years.

What should I read?

Anything you like! The Children’s Librarians would love to make recommendations and would be happy to show you around the department.

Do I have to read 1,000 different books?

Nope! If you read the same book 15 times, count each reading. Repetition is great for babies and toddlers it reinforces memory and sequencing skills and increases vocabulary.

What are the benefits?

The benefits are enormous! You will strengthen your parent- child relationship, stimulate brain development and build language and literacy skills that last a lifetime.
